So, with this overhead, free space, and (wow) actual data, how is it all stored in the data block?SIMPLE BLOCK LAYOUTThe data block Header (fixed) is at the beginning of the block. A small tail is at the end of the block (the tail is for block consistency checking). Everything else (variable header and data rows) fits between the beginning and the end.Variable header info grows from the top down